I was there last feb, just south of pv. The malacon is pretty cool. It's where you'll find all the street venders, also check out the pirate ship boats you can go out on at night, I never did but they looked like a lot of fun!
Also check out the hidden beach on the marieta islands or something like that. Very cool!

Last time we were there, back in 2007, PV was a lot of fun. But you will find that since it is a port city, the city itself is quite Americanized. They have a Wal-Mart and Sam's club right opposite of the cruise terminal. They also have a Chuck E Cheese, Hooters restaurant, and regular fast food like Burger King and McD's.

Which resort are you planning on staying at?

There are lots of things to do in PV. There are some good clubs to go to too if you are into that stuff.

We went to that market. It was meh, but then again I am not into that stuff. It is dollar crap made and pedelled to "tourist".
WWE type wrestler masks. Hats/sombrero's, cheap fake jewelery. T-shirts. Shooter cups. Deformed Corona bottles.

It was interesting to take the city bus from the resort into the city. Watching the bus driver drive a manual bus with no synchro's so there is heavy gear grind with every gear shift.
